given the mean of a data set is 7 and the standard deviation is 2, where will about 68% of the data lie? 5 to 9 1 to 2 9 to 10

Explanation:

Step1: Recall the empirical rule

For a normal - distributed data set, about 68% of the data lies within 1 standard deviation of the mean.

Step2: Calculate the lower and upper bounds

The lower bound is $\text{mean}-\text{standard deviation}=7 - 2=5$.
The upper bound is $\text{mean}+\text{standard deviation}=7 + 2=9$.

Answer:

5 to 9
